You can provide access to the Diary for individuals who are not registered on Multi Me through a secure URL and password sent via email. These users are referred to as 'Email Access Users' on Multi Me.
The Email Access User simply clicks the link, enters the password, and gains access to the Diary. They will be able to view the Diary and contribute to specific Diary Logs they’ve been granted access to. This secure access works on any device with an internet connection via a web browser.
As the Diary Admin or User's Buddy, follow these steps to invite someone:
1. Navigate to the Diary you want to share then click on 'Manage Access' to begin the process.
2. In the Manage Access area click on the 'Invite by Email' option
3. In the pop up add the details of the email access user. If you want the link to be ongoing select 'never' in the expiry selection. Click 'Send Invitation' and email with a link and a password will be sent to the Email Access User.
4. The Email Access User will now appear in the Manage Access table. Click the pencil icon next to their name to define the access permissions you want to grant. Note: If you don't set their access, they will not be able to view or interact with the Diary!
5. Clicking the pencil icon will expand the sections of the Diary under the user in the table. You can then assign access by simply clicking the eye icon for read-only (view) access, or the pencil icon for read and write access to specific sections of the Diary. Note: Email Access Users cannot be given write access to the Diary Blog. To enable write access, you will need to invite the user to register and join the Circle.
Additionally, you can click the notification and alert icons to send the user reminders to update the Diary and receive email notifications for new entries.
Note: If a link has expired, you can extend or modify the expiry date by clicking on the 'Valid until' link under the user’s email. Additionally, you can copy their unique access link (URL) and password for future reference.
